ANBIT aims to develop a new computing paradigm called Analog Photonic Computation, leveraging programmable integrated photonics for efficient real-time processing. This approach seeks to address limitations in digital electronics for applications like medical imaging and robotic control.
For over 5 decades, digital electronics has covered the increasing demand for computing power thanks to a periodic doubling of transistor density in integrated circuits.
Currently, such scaling law is reaching its fundamental limit, leading to the emergence of a large gamut of applications that cannot be supported by digital electronics, specifically, those that involve real-time analog multi-data processing, e.g., medical diagnostic imaging, drug design and robotic control, among others.
